WARNING
Before connecting any option or peripheral equipment, turn off the power and wait
for 15 minutes or more until the charge lamp turns off. Then, confirm that the
voltage between P and N is safe with a voltage tester and others. Otherwise, an
electric shock may occur. In addition, always confirm from the front of the servo
amplifier whether the charge lamp is off or not.
CAUTION
Use the specified auxiliary equipment and options. Unspecified ones may lead to a
fault or fire.
